#e1449e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e1449e is composed of 88.2% red, 26.7%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 69.8% magenta, 29.8%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 325.6 degrees, a saturation of 72.4% and a lightness of 57.5%. #e1449e color hex could be obtained by blending #ff88ff with #c3003d. Closest websafe color is: #cc3399.

#e1449e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e1449e has RGB values of R:225, G:68, B:158 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.7, Y:0.3,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 14763166.
